Protsenko> // Chemical Physics Letters. - 2000. - Vol.321, №3-4. - С. 315-320 Рубрики: ФИЗИКА Кл.слова (ненормированные): MOLECULAR-DYNAMICS SIMULATION -- LIQUID-VAPOR INTERFACE -- LENNARD-JONES FLUID Аннотация: We present the molecular dynamic simulation results for the liquid–vapour interface of the pure Lennard–Jones fluid. The thermodynamical properties, the surface tension, the effective thickness of interfacial layer and the mean-square amplitude of capillary waves are determined. Calculations have been performed at cut-off radii of the intermolecular potential rc1=2.6σ and rc2=6.78σ. It is shown that the cut-off radius of the interaction potential in the two-phase systems should be chosen to be larger than that in the one-phase systems for an adequate representation of properties |
